A new 10-classroom tuition block constructed through the National Government Constituencies Development Fund (NG-CDF) was officially commissioned at Sergoit Comprehensive School in Kamariny Ward, Elgeyo Marakwet County, marking a major boost to education infrastructure in the area. The project was commissioned by Interior and National Administration Cabinet Secretary Kipchumba Murkomen during the school’s 70th anniversary…
